Adobe is driving strategic growth with global Private Equity (PE), Venture Capital (VC), and Sovereign Wealth (SWF) firms through its new go-to-market – Adobe Private Capital (APC). APC partners with Operating Partners and Portfolio Companies globally to unlock transformative value using Adobe’s integrated technology.

Position Overview

As the Adobe Private Capital Enterprise Architect, you will be the senior technical authority within the APC team, working at the intersection of deep technical architecture and value creation. You will advise PE/VC/SWF firms and their portfolio companies on maximizing ROI from Adobe solutions and the broader ecosystem.

What You’ll Do

  • Partner with the APC team and regional field technical teams to translate value hypotheses into robust technical architectures and roadmaps that deliver measurable value creation for portfolio companies
  • Lead the design of end-to-end solution architectures across Adobe Customer Experience Orchestration, Creativity & Productivity, and the wider ecosystem, including complex integrations with third‑party platforms, cloud environments (AWS, Azure, Google Cloud), and legacy systems
  • Conduct technical assessments and North Star architecture reviews for priority portfolio companies, defining current‑state, target‑state, and transition roadmaps aligned to PE value levers (EBITDA improvement, revenue growth, operational efficiency)
  • Develop compelling technical cases and business cases that link Adobe capabilities to portfolio company priorities, supporting pipeline acceleration and executive decision‑making with Operating Partners and C‑level stakeholders
  • Provide architecture oversight during pre‑ and post‑sales phases, ensuring seamless transition into value realisation, governance model execution, and long‑term adoption of Adobe solutions
  • Collaborate with Adobe product, engineering, and services teams to influence roadmap priorities and deliver customised solutions that address unique PE/VC/SWF requirements
  • Act as a trusted technical advisor to APC leadership, regional teams, and external stakeholders, delivering thought leadership through workshops, executive briefings, and industry events
  • Contribute to joint governance models by defining technical milestones, risk mitigation strategies, and performance metrics that track value realisation across portfolio engagements
  • Stay at the forefront of cloud architecture patterns, integration best practices, and emerging technologies (AI, generative AI, data platforms) to strengthen Adobe’s positioning within private capital value creation playbooks

What You Need to Succeed

  • 10+ years of enterprise architecture or senior technical presales experience in SaaS, enterprise software, or digital transformation environments, with proven success in complex, multi‑solution engagements
  • Strong technical depth across Adobe Customer Experience Orchestration and Creativity & Productivity solutions, plus broad knowledge of cloud architectures, API integrations, data platforms, and third‑party ecosystem technologies
  • Demonstrated ability to connect technical architecture decisions directly to business value outcomes, financial impact, and PE/VC‑style value creation frameworks
  • Experience working with Private Equity, Venture Capital, or large enterprise transformation programmes is highly advantageous
  • Outstanding advisory and communication skills, with the ability to present complex technical concepts to C‑level executives, Operating Partners, and non‑technical stakeholders
  • Strong project and program management skills to drive technical alignment across matrixed teams and ensure on‑time delivery of commitments
  • Analytical and strategic thinker who can develop clear roadmaps, manage objections, and provide compelling thought leadership
  • Passion for digital innovation and a proactive, collaborative approach in a global, dynamic organisation
